The final episode of Attack On Titan Final Season Part 2 streamed a teaser video at the end revealing that the conclusion (kanketsu-hen) of Attack On Titan Final Season will air in 2023 on NHK.
The English version of the teaser calls the conclusion as “Part 3”.
Attack on Titan Final Season Part 2 ended with episode 12, leaving more than 20 chapters of the manga left to be adapted in Attack on Titan Final Season Part 3.
Episode 12 included the content from the previously skipped chapter 123 of the manga titled, Island Devils. The episode focuses on a flashback where Eren, Mikasa, Armin and the other survey corps move to Marley to carry out negotiations.
The episode also featured the much anticipated scene of Eren asking Mikasa what he meant to her. The episode then shifted its attention to the Rumbling and Eren’s slow descent into accepting the bleak path that he was supposed to choose.
The Final Season’s Part 2 premiered on Jan 9, 2022 in Japan. Crunchyroll and Funimation were streaming the episodes simultaneously as they aired. The dubbed version of Attack on Titan: Final Season part 2 began airing on Toonami on Feb 12, 2022. Funimation began streaming the episodes from the next day, Feb 13, 2022.
